WebDec 26, 2024 · "only do one thing" is a guideline to help all of these things that we care about. It's not a rule you must follow. Because pedantically, the overwhelming majority of functions do more than one thing. "Add these numbers and return them" is two things. "Check this input and save it to the database" is two things.
